Checked it out.

Well I checked out the Transform at my Sprint store yesterday. It does appear to have some lag that I would not be able to live with. It takes a second or two for things to respond, and scrolling isn't very fluid. Now this was a demo phone and I didn't reboot or anything like that.

I'm still thinking my wife will be OK with it, but man compared to the Epic I just wouldn't be able to use this on a day to day basis. We'll see tomorrow, I'm taking her there to try em out.

We have Epic and Transform so we can make comparison. Stock Transform with Sprint ID is slow. But with Launcher Pro, it's becomes pretty fast (but not as fast as Epic). My wife loves it (she hasn't toyed with my Epic).
